Saturday, September 24th is National Public Lands Day and we are celebrating at the Gladie visitor center! There will be a full day of festivities including crafts and activities in the morning then a cleanup hike during the afternoon. Activities and crafts will be centered around teaching families the importance of being stewards of the land on all our adventures. There will be a Leave No Trace scavenger hunt, an introduction to Woodsy Owl, a binocular craft, and Red River Gorge coloring pages. Afterwards at 1 pm we will be taking a hike on the Bison Way trail and up Gladie Creek to pick up trash, learn the 7 principles of Leave No Trace, and discuss the ecosystem services Red River Gorge provides. For the hike please bring water, sunscreen, shoes you are comfortable walking in and getting wet, and gloves if you have them; we will provide bags, grabbers, buckets, trash bags, and gloves if necessary.
